Transaction 8b91aec15f125c5098ec2ac1f71311dd434cd199a85a001e31b249dd594dac02

3 Input
2 Outputs
  • 8b91aec15f125c5098ec2ac1f71311dd434cd199a85a001e31b249dd594dac02:0
  • value  10231261
    address  13HUihyDBLEkVKaUS8hs5j9LHk4dZBY1mS
  • 8b91aec15f125c5098ec2ac1f71311dd434cd199a85a001e31b249dd594dac02:1
  • value  1189068
    address  3Jc3CXuxVSkoPF2Saz9rhQ9FrKskmP851w